    How much money can you save with a rechargeable battery?

    Over five years, you'll have saved a minimum of $64 if you replace four batteries each month. Of course, more frequent battery users will see much bigger savings of $200+ in the same time period.     Do you need rechargeable batteries?

    Of course, you don't have to use rechargeable batteries in all of your battery-powered electronics. If you have batteries in a wall clock or TV remote that you only have to replace once every year or two, it may be cheaper to stick to the $0.25-$0.75 per battery cost as opposed to investing in rechargeable batteries.

    What materials are used to make a battery cell?

    Here is a more detailed look at the battery cell assembly process: Cathodes: Lithium cobalt oxide, lithium manganese oxide, lithium nickel cobalt aluminum oxide, or lithium iron phosphate. Anodes: Carbon, graphite, silicon, or lithium titanate. Separators: Polyethylene or polypropylene, coated with ceramic or aluminum oxide.

    What are the stages of battery manufacturing?

    The first stage is electrode manufacturing, which involves mixing, coating, calendering, slitting, and electrode making processes. The second stage is cell assembly, where the separator is inserted, and the battery structure is connected to terminals or cell tabs.

    How do EV battery cells work?

    In most EV battery cell manufacturing, sealing is performed under a vacuum to remove air bubbles from the solution. The formation process involves carefully charging and discharging the cells in a controlled fashion. This process creates a solid electrolyte interface (SEI) layer that helps ensure battery longevity and stability.

    How does a blade battery work?

    This is in addition to a 15 GWh battery plant in Fuzhou in China's Jiangxi province, which was announced in December 2021. The blade battery is LFP cells in a special, elongated format. The elongated cells are directly inserted into the battery pack; there is no intermediate step via modules. This increases the energy density at the pack level.

    What is a blade battery?

    The blade battery is an in-house development from BYD. The name refers to the unusual format: the pouch cells are very long and therefore resemble a sword blade. The elongated cells, which are produced exclusively using LFP chemistry, are installed in the battery packs at right angles to the direction of travel.

    Do electric car batteries have a usable capacity?

    All electric car batteries have a usable capacity that's slightly less than the total capacity because this helps extend the life of the battery pack since that buffer prevents it from ever being completely charged. For example, the BMW iX's battery pack has a total capacity of 111.5 kWh, but its usable capacity is 106.3 kWh.

    What is the first level of battery classification?

    For the echelon utilization of retired LIBs, safety is the priority. Therefore, the first level of battery classification can use the side reaction characteristics as a criterion, which is a one-dimensional classification problem. The purpose of the classification is to classify LIBs with the same or similar side reaction characteristics.

    How should lithium batteries be classified?

    LIBs for power-based scenarios should be classified based on the internal resistance and remaining life. Therefore, the battery classification can be simplified into a two-dimensional classification problem. For energy–power application scenarios, batteries should be classified based on the capacity, internal resistance, and remaining life.

    What is China's Lithium-based new energy industry?

    The industry of lithium-based new energy is defined as a strategic emerging industry in China. In 2022, China's lithium battery exports amounted to nearly CNY 342.7 billion. China's lithium-ion battery shipments reached a total of 660.8 GWh in 2022, accounting for over 60% of the global market share.
